logo

Output ab7643a31266c08edc5a6bfbd89e963d66116b07f51d8b7fee43378c0295f576:0

value
17759527
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ddc64fbf09e73623820bbedfcaf9674845ade1b7 OP_EQUALVERIFY OP_CHECKSIG
address
1MDduKYWoZ1oM66tdrEPfsm3TSzyK4ThZt
transaction
ab7643a31266c08edc5a6bfbd89e963d66116b07f51d8b7fee43378c0295f576